  • BannersThumbnail (39).png

    Professional Healer Training Q&A 07.30.2026

    In this Professional Healer Training Q&A, Master Robert answered a wide range of student questions while deepening the practical understanding of Qigong healing. He emphasized trusting intuition, working with Qi rather than medical labels, refining healing techniques, and developing greater confidence through continued practice. Throughout the session, he reminded students that effective healing comes from cultivating both skill and inner awareness.

    ๐Ÿ”น Trusting Intuition While Treating โ€” Master Robert encouraged students to trust the energetic sensations they experience during treatment. Whether sensing density, emptiness, warmth, or resistance, these perceptions become valuable guidance as healing skills mature. Rather than relying solely on analysis, practitioners are encouraged to gradually develop their intuitive connection with Qi through consistent practice.

    ๐Ÿ”น Healing the Root, Not the Diagnosis โ€” Responding to questions about treating chronic illnesses and injuries, Master Robert explained that Qigong healing focuses on clearing energetic blockages rather than becoming attached to medical diagnoses. Regardless of the condition, the goal is to restore the natural flow of Qi, allowing the body's own healing intelligence to function more effectively.

    ๐Ÿ”น Protection, Space Clearing, and Working with Different Environments โ€” Master Robert provided practical guidance on energetic protection through WoGu, preparing treatment spaces using the S-Pattern, and working in clients' homes. He explained how practitioners can harmonize and reorganize the energy of a space both before and after treatments while maintaining their own energetic stability without becoming overly dependent on protective techniques.

    ๐Ÿ”น Refining Healing Techniques Through Correct Sequence and Practice โ€” Master Robert clarified many technical aspects of the training, including Sword Finger, Dian Xue Opening and Empowerment, Tai Chi Press, Reverse Abdominal Breathing, Magic Palm, and Ocean Waves breathing. He emphasized that each technique has its own purpose and sequence, and that greater effectiveness comes from understanding how they complement one another rather than relying on any single method.

    This Q&A reinforced that becoming an effective healer involves much more than learning techniques. By trusting intuitive awareness, maintaining a strong personal Qi field, and applying each method with clarity and proper sequence, practitioners gradually develop the confidence, sensitivity, and wisdom needed to support healing in themselves and others.

    Professional Healer Training Q&A 06.02.2026 ( Module 2)

    In this second Professional Healer Training Q&A, Master Robert expanded on the practical application of Qigong healing, helping students deepen their understanding of treatment techniques while reinforcing the importance of trust, adaptability, and consistent practice.

    ๐Ÿ”น Healing Through Qi, Not Physical Position โ€” Addressing questions about treating back pain, Master Robert explained that healing is not limited by physical positioning. Whether a person is lying face up or face down, Qi follows intention. What matters most is the healer's focused mind and the natural flow of energy, not the angle of the body.

    ๐Ÿ”น Building Lasting Healing Power โ€” In response to questions about feeling energized after practice but not retaining the benefits, Master Robert emphasized the importance of continually connecting with Universal Qi. Rather than relying on personal energy, healers cultivate themselves through regular practice, allowing healing to become increasingly effortless, sustainable, and restorative for both practitioner and recipient.

    ๐Ÿ”น Healing Is a Gradual Process โ€” When discussing treatment duration and whether every imbalance must be resolved in a single session, Master Robert reminded students that healing unfolds over time. Rather than striving for immediate perfection, practitioners should work with care, seal the treatment properly, and allow progress to develop naturally through consistent sessions.

    ๐Ÿ”น Working With, Not Against, the Flow of Qi โ€” Master Robert also clarified several important techniques, including Ocean Whispers and Tai Chi Press. He explained that natural breathing should never be forced, and that Tai Chi Press works by gently pressing and moving beneath the skin with balanced intention rather than simply sliding across the surface. The goal is always to harmonize the flow of Qi, not to rely on physical force.

    This Q&A reinforced that effective healing comes from developing a calm mind, trusting the natural intelligence of Qi, and allowing skill and sensitivity to grow through steady practice rather than force or perfection.

    Professional Healer Training Q&A 06.04.2026

    In this first Q&A session of the Professional Healer Training, Robert offered deeper guidance on the foundations of Qigong healing, helping students refine both their understanding and their confidence as emerging healers:

    ๐Ÿ”น Simplicity, Confidence & Energetic Trust โ€” Responding to many questions about Dian Xue Opening, Robert emphasized that healing is not about overcomplicating visualization or mentally controlling energy. Rather than analyzing where the light originates or forcing precise energetic mechanics, practitioners are encouraged to trust the process, stay relaxed, and allow Qi to flow naturally through focused intention and presence.

    ๐Ÿ”น Healing Is Built Through Practice & Experience โ€” Addressing concerns about doubt, sensitivity, and โ€œdoing it correctly,โ€ Robert reassured students that confidence develops gradually through consistent practice. Sensations, energetic perceptions, and intuitive understanding naturally deepen over time. The healerโ€™s path is not about immediate perfection, but about steady cultivation and direct experience.

    ๐Ÿ”น The Importance of Gentleness & Adaptability โ€” Robert explained that healing techniques should always adapt to the individual. Whether working with highly sensitive people, elderly clients, children, or those with physical limitations, the key is not force but responsiveness, stability, and care. Techniques can be softened, modified, or even performed remotely while still maintaining energetic effectiveness.

    ๐Ÿ”น Healing Beyond Diagnosis โ€” Robert also spoke about the deeper philosophy behind Qigong healing, explaining that true healing focuses less on labeling illness and more on restoring energetic flow, openness, and vitality. Rather than becoming attached to diagnoses or symptoms, practitioners are encouraged to cultivate energetic listening, sensitivity, and the ability to support transformation through presence and connection.

    This Q&A revealed that the foundation of healing is not only technique, but the gradual development of trust, awareness, compassion, and the ability to work with Qi in a natural and grounded way.
